Latest Technological Developments to Counter Russian Drone Threats

The ⁤US Army ⁢is ramping up its defenses in response to⁣ the⁣ increasing⁣ threat of Russian strike drones. In an effort to stay ahead of the game, the Army is investing ⁢in the‍ latest technological developments to counter these evolving threats.

Some⁤ of the new technologies being implemented‍ include:

  • AI-powered detection systems that can identify and‌ track drone threats more accurately.
  • High-energy laser weapons designed to take down drones quickly and effectively.
  • Advanced electronic warfare capabilities to disrupt enemy drone⁤ communications and navigation systems.
